Shop-built Jigs and Fixtures by Woodsmith Magazine

Classic cabinet making requires a vast array of fixtures and jigs to form the essential elements of the furniture. This book helps you to assemble these invaluable aids - from pushblocks and featherboards to router trammels, dovetail jigs and drill press tables - and create a workshop capable of producing professional work. - Workshop-proven tips & techniques - Over 200 step-by-step drawings - - Material lists - Cutting diagrams - Jig plans for safe and accurate work - - Unique Designer's Notebook pages for improving and customising - * The Custom Woodworking series gives you much more than other woodworking books: they are densely packed, brilliantly presented and highly detailed books with complete plans, unique plans and joinery options to fit your individual needs. * Stay-flat spiral binding (within a sturdy hardback case) allows the step-by-step illustrations to be followed in the workshop.
